Transaction 00f35f24f9edeffc7b33d79a3995e695f423ce577767baf2a37caa41b3268006
1 Input
2 Outputs
- 00f35f24f9edeffc7b33d79a3995e695f423ce577767baf2a37caa41b3268006:0
- 00f35f24f9edeffc7b33d79a3995e695f423ce577767baf2a37caa41b3268006:1
value 16000000
address 1CesMqoPRUbsKoEVepSzYghdcz3qrQp2uM
value 534332
address 146FfqozW5FtJLyGvPzJGPSyfzJ8jfgmmP